dbMTS

dbMTS catalogs and annotates single nucleotide variants (SNVs) within microRNA (miRNA) seed regions in human 3' untranslated regions (3' UTRs) and provides functional predictions of their impacts on miRNA-mediated gene regulation.


Key Features:

  • Comprehensive Collection: catalogs all potential SNVs within miRNA seed regions across human 3' UTRs.
  • Functional Predictions and Annotations: provides computational predictions of variant effects on miRNA binding and annotations describing potential biological impacts and disease relevance.
  • Variant Filtering and Prioritization for WES: integrates predictions and annotations to support filtering and prioritization of SNVs from whole exome sequencing (WES) datasets.

Scientific Applications:

  • Identification of Functional SNVs: identification of SNVs that may alter miRNA targeting and modulate gene expression.
  • Prioritization of Genetic Variants: prioritization and ranking of SNVs by predicted functional impact for studies of genetic contributions to disease and phenotype.
  • miRNA Regulatory Research: support for investigations into miRNA–mRNA interactions and noncoding RNA regulatory roles.

Methodology:

Systematically identifies SNVs within miRNA seed regions by analyzing human 3' UTR sequences and applies computational tools to predict effects on miRNA binding and gene regulation, with annotations indicating potential biological impact and disease relevance.
